According to Reuters, instead of producing 8.9 inch Kindle Fire, it appears to be that Amazon will leave that project and focus on making the 10.1 inch Kindle Fire. This surely increase the speculation that Amazon does really have intention or “secret” goal, which is to compete with iPad, instead of just being the king in Android tablet market.

Anyway, this 10.1-inch Kindle Fire is planned to launch in the third quarter of 2012. There is no exact price detail of this tablet yet, but seeing the history of Kindle Fire as a cheapest tablet pc, then I don’t think Amazon would have any intention to change the “cheap price tag” aspect on its creation, since it’s the best selling point of this tablet.
